DIANE'S STORY: For a long time I have loved reading stories and autobiographies about a wide range of people. Family history began to intrigue me, and then one day in 2001 my eldest daughter Sally brought home a book which had stories of a member of my mother's family - the Keatings of Woodend, Victoria.
Unbeknown to me, my mother's cousin Lyn Kennedy (nee Mullett) was also researching our family. She wrote
"The definitive impetus came from Diane Cummings, grandaughter of Leslie Mullett, who rang me late one evening in 2001 saying she was trying to find information about her family background. And so the fascinating investigation was born! To understand why and how things happened as they did, it became necessary to trawl through some of the genealogical information, which is now more readily available to seekers using the Internet.
It is Diane who has undertaken most of the painstaking work in this regard. She has also been indefatigable in following leads and calling or e-mailing people who might have clues to help us unravel the tangle of dates and names. The journey has been, by turn, tedious, exhilarating and full of unexpected revelations. Along the way we have found some wonderful and very helpful people, both relatives and complete strangers."
This work began as a search for my mother's family. Along the way I have met some wonderful people who have shared their memories with me.
THANK YOU EVERYONE. We all hope that you will enjoy our story too.
